6 tips to keep your car clean, protected during North Carolina’s pollen season

RALEIGH, N.C. (WNCN) — Pollen is blanketing everything this time of year, so we want to help you avoid spending too much at the car wash with a few tips.

According to The Car Place NC, pollen can cause damage to the car’s interior and exterior with its acidic effect. It offered these six tips on how to protect your car from pollen.

  1. Park inside

  2. Rinse & wash
    – Pollen is so small and can hide in every nook and cranny.
    – Take your car to a car wash to ensure all of the small particles are out of areas you can’t see

  3. Wax your vehicle
    – This adds a protective layer to your vehicle and could prevent pollen from sticking.

  4. Check your filters
    – Your engine filter collects dust, debris, and pollen. The cleaner the filter, the better the vehicle will run.
    – The Car Place NC said having an expert technician check your engine filter is best. It’s recommended to replace the engine filter every 15,000-30,000 miles.

  5. Replace your Interior Cabin Filter
    – Keep the air in your car clean and easier to breathe by replacing the cabin filter.
    – The Car Place NC says this is especially important for people with allergies.
    – It also helps to reduce the layer of yellow film that can appear on the inside of your car.

  6. Clean your wiper blades
    – Pollen can build up and become a paste on wiper blades.
    – The paste can spread across your windshield, so clean your wipers once a week by running a paper towel along the blades.

Lastly, take it easy on your vehicle while washing. Too much washing and pressure can cause paint to chip off the vehicle. A car expert can help prep your vehicle of the season changes and extend its life.
